Teable开源数据协作平台:企业级数据管理解决方案
【免费下载链接】teable项目地址: https://gitcode.com/GitHub_Trending/te/teable
在数字化转型的浪潮中,企业面临着日益增长的数据管理需求。Teable作为一款开源的数据协作平台,为企业提供了专业级的数据管理和团队协作能力。本文将详细介绍如何快速部署Teable,并深入解析其核心功能特性。
快速部署指南
环境准备与依赖检查
在开始部署前,请确保您的系统已安装必要的运行环境:
# 验证Docker环境 docker --version docker compose version获取项目源码
git clone https://gitcode.com/GitHub_Trending/te/teable.git cd teable/dockers/examples/standalone/一键启动服务
执行以下命令启动所有服务组件:
docker compose up -d系统将自动启动四个核心服务容器,包括应用服务、数据库、缓存和文件存储。
核心功能解析
多视图数据展示
Teable支持多种数据视图,满足不同场景下的数据展示需求:
看板视图- 适用于任务管理和工作流跟踪
网格视图- 提供传统表格的数据组织方式
仪表板视图- 集成多种图表和关键指标
企业级数据管理能力
销售机会管理
在销售管理场景中,Teable能够有效跟踪销售机会的全生命周期。通过看板视图,团队成员可以清晰了解每个机会的状态、负责人和关键信息。
- 状态跟踪:从初步接洽到最终成交的完整流程
- 负责人分配:明确每个机会的负责人和协作关系
- 优先级管理:通过颜色编码快速识别高价值机会
项目缺陷跟踪
在软件开发场景中,Teable的看板视图能够有效管理缺陷和问题:
该界面展示了:
- 状态分类:阻塞、进行中、已完成等清晰的工作流
- 负责人分配:明确每个问题的处理人员
- 优先级标识:通过颜色区分问题的重要程度
系统架构设计
容器化部署架构
Teable采用微服务架构设计,通过Docker容器实现服务隔离和弹性扩展:
- 应用服务容器:承载前后端业务逻辑
- 数据库容器:PostgreSQL提供数据持久化存储
- 缓存容器:Redis加速数据访问
- 存储容器:MinIO管理文件和附件
数据安全保障
所有关键数据都通过Docker Volume实现持久化存储,确保数据不会因容器重启而丢失。
性能优化策略
资源配置建议
根据团队规模和数据量,建议采用以下资源配置:
services: app: deploy: resources: limits: cpus: '2' memory: 4G数据库调优配置
对于大规模数据应用,建议优化PostgreSQL配置参数:
- shared_buffers:提升数据缓存效率
- work_mem:优化查询性能
- maintenance_work_mem:改善维护操作速度
应用场景深度解析
客户关系管理
在客户数据管理方面,Teable的网格视图提供了强大的数据处理能力:
- 数据筛选:快速定位目标客户群体
- 排序分组:按业务需求组织数据展示
- 批量操作:支持对多条记录的统一处理
团队协作效率提升
通过多用户同时编辑、实时数据同步等功能,Teable显著提升了团队协作效率。
运维管理实践
系统监控与维护
建议定期检查以下系统指标:
- 容器资源使用率
- 数据库连接状态
- 应用服务响应时间
数据备份与恢复
建立定期的数据备份机制:
# 数据库备份 docker exec teable-postgres pg_dump -U postgres teable > backup.sql技术优势总结
Teable作为开源数据协作平台,具备以下核心优势:
- 灵活的数据视图:支持多种数据展示方式
- 强大的协作功能:多用户实时编辑和评论
- 企业级安全:完善的数据权限管理
- 可扩展架构:支持根据业务需求进行定制开发
通过本文的介绍,您已经了解了Teable的核心功能和部署方法。无论是初创团队还是成熟企业,Teable都能为您提供专业级的数据协作解决方案。
【免费下载链接】teable项目地址: https://gitcode.com/GitHub_Trending/te/teable
创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考